Types of Black School Shoes for Girls
When shopping for black school shoes for girls, considering the various types available can help you find the perfect fit. Here are some popular styles:
Mary Janes
Mary Janes feature a closed-toe design with a strap going across the instep. They are adored for their durability and comfort. This style is especially popular among younger girls.
Loafers
Loafers are slip-on shoes that blend comfort with style. They are suitable for formal occasions as well as everyday wear, making them versatile for school environments.
Sneakers
While traditionally not part of a uniform, many schools allow black sneakers as part of their dress code. They provide the comfort needed for active play during recess and sport activities.
Ankle Boots
For older girls, ankle boots can offer a stylish alternative. They pair well with both uniforms and casual outfits, providing a fashionable edge without compromising comfort.

How to Choose the Right Black School Shoes
When selecting black school shoes for girls, there are several factors to consider to ensure comfort, durability, and good support:
Fit
It’s vital to find the right fit. Shoes that are too tight can cause blisters, while those that are too loose can lead to discomfort and instability. Aim for a fit that allows for a little wiggle room.
Material Quality
Opt for shoes made from high-quality materials. Leather, synthetic materials, and breathable fabrics are commonly preferred for their durability and ease of cleaning.
Arch Support
Good arch support is crucial for growing feet. Choose brands and styles that offer adequate cushioning to prevent discomfort during long hours of wear.
Ease of Wear
Consider how easy the shoes are to put on and take off. Slip-ons, velcro, or adjustable straps can be convenient options for younger children.

Tips for Maintaining Black School Shoes
To prolong the life of your girl’s black school shoes, consider the following tips:
Proper Cleaning
Regularly clean shoes to maintain their appearance. Use a soft cloth and mild soap for leather shoes and machine-washable materials as required.
Storage Solutions
Store shoes in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ight to avoid fading.
Rotate Shoes
If possible, consider rotating between pairs to reduce wear and tear on a single pair.
